What is Ketamine?
Ketamine is a dissociative anesthetic that has actually been utilized in medical settings for years. Initially approved for use in surgeries, it is now being checked out for its fast antidepressant effects. When administered in controlled doses, ketamine acts on the brain's neurotransmitters, particularly glutamate, promoting neural plasticity and possibly providing remedy for incapacitating state of mind disorders.

How is Ketamine Administered?
There are several methods of administering ketamine, each of which can have different effects and effectiveness:
| Method | Description |
|---|---|
| Intravenous (IV) | Administered directly into the bloodstream for immediate effects. |
| Intramuscular (IM) | Injected into a muscle, often used in emergency situation settings. |
| Nasal Spray | A newer type available for home usage, providing simpler access. |
| Oral Tablets | Less typical and usually not as reliable as other methods. |
Legal Status of Ketamine in the UK
In the UK, ketamine is classified as a Class B drug under the Misuse of Drugs Act 1971. This means that it is prohibited to have or provide ketamine without a prescription from a registered physician. Despite its legal status, ketamine centers have actually emerged, providing treatments to patients with specific mental health conditions.

What to Expect from Treatment
When seeking ketamine treatment, patients typically undergo an initial assessment to discuss their medical history, existing signs, and treatment objectives. If a clinician decides that ketamine treatment is suitable, they will describe a treatment strategy, which might consist of a series of infusions or nasal spray applications.
Common Treatment Cycle:
- Initial evaluation and consultation.
- A series of 6-12 infusions over a few weeks.
- Follow-up sessions, potentially spaced out gradually.

Q4: What are the side effects of ketamine?
A: Common adverse effects consist of lightheadedness, fatigue, and dissociative feelings. Severe adverse effects are unusual however can consist of cardiovascular concerns and bladder issues.
